    Explaining the key concepts and characteristics of Social change and planning in India, this book is a valuable guide for students of Sociology. It draws the present and past scenario of change, planning and regional development in a way that it interests the reader for a deeper understanding of the subject. It also lays a lot of stress on planning strategies and models and analyses and assesses the various five year plans.
